CURRENT NEED

We are seeking a Warehouse IT Support Engineer to join our team at our Santa Fe Springs, CA distribution center.

Position Description

Responsible for the system administration, technical support, uptime, and continuous improvement of several integrated systems that control and automate that pharmaceutical distribution center fulfillment process. Strong verbal and written communication, demonstrated analytical and technical problem-solving skills, and the ability to work autonomously and in a team environment are essential to be successful in this role. Previous experience being a self-starter and exercising sound judgment in high pressure situations is required.

A typical week is Sunday-Thursday and a typical day starts at 4pm and ends at 1am.

Routine work day consist of system checks, walking, standing, and climbing stairs to perform physical observations of conveyor flow, system monitoring, assigned projects and tasks, support calls, troubleshooting problems, end user engagement, virtual and face-to-face meetings, status updates and individual development.

Travel up to 20 - 25% is required for meetings, training, and projects. Onsite support will be provided to the Santa Fe Springs Distribution Center and remote support will be provided to a global network of distribution centers. Willingness to work flexible shifts and scheduling including nights, weekends, and holidays. Additionally, rotate 24x7 on-call duties with members of team.

Minimum Requirements

Typically has 4+ years relevant experience

Critical Skills

  • Expertise in one or more areas of IT such as Microsoft administration, virtual computing administration, or networking administration
  • Experience with setup and configuration of server and desktop hardware
  • Efficient and effective troubleshooting skills in a high-pressure environment
  • Ability to perform detailed root cause analysis
  • Understanding of networking concepts such as DNS, DHCP, HTTP, OSI Model, TCP/IP protocols and client-server applications
  • Strong troubleshooting skills of integrated multi-tiered systems and applications
  • Solid understanding of relational databases and connectivity protocols
  • Proven skills in PC repair, troubleshooting, deployment, and decommissioning
  • Use of basic tools such as screw drivers, wrenches, ratchets, sockets
  • Lift, unbox, rack servers, mount PCs and peripherals, perform cable management
  • Observation or troubleshooting of devices above ground level from a lift

Additional Skills

  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ills in English (in person and via phone/radio) with peers, internal customers, management, contractors and vendors.
  • Microsoft MCSE, Active Directory
  • Advanced virtualization systems administration skills, VCP or equivalent
  • Linux+, Network+, Server+ certification or equivalent
  • PLC Knowledge and support
  • Experience with warehouse control systems, material handling systems, automation systems and equipment
  • Knowledge of cyber security threats, vulnerabilities and mitigation tactics
  • Basic understanding of distribution and fulfillment processes
  • Ability to explain complex IT concepts in simple terms
  • Ability to manage high priority projects
  • Basic knowledge of mechanical and electrical principles
  • Proven ability to work successfully with limited supervision

Education

4-year degree in computer science or related field or equivalent experience

Physical Requirements

Ability to stand/walk for 8-10 hours per day
